QUICK TIP

🥀 The Surprise Aisle Dip

Surprise, surprise.
We hear it’s been catching a few of us out this wedding season. Thinking we nailed the shot of the happy moment coming down the aisle, turning our backs (so we don’t trip over backwards), ONLY to see in the corner of our eye the couple going for a big swooping dip kiss in the aisle. Dang, you missed it.

You can love it or hate it. But it’s back, it’s trending and happening more and more at a wedding near you! So this is your official reminder to stay on guard while walking back down the aisle and make sure you get that shot.
